Maya 动画2025 年 6 月 13 日 | 阅读 7 分钟 它是一款强大的建模和动画软件,常用于电视、游戏和电影领域。它提供了有效的工具来创建令人信服的视觉效果,使艺术家能够赋予环境、物体和角色生命。其动画过程的主要组成部分包括动态模拟、运动路径和关键帧。其功能包括用于微调时间和运动曲线的图形编辑器,以及用于为角色提供骨骼和控制以实现流畅运动的骨骼绑定。它通过支持逼真的物理效果和视觉效果,使用户能够创建令人惊叹的图形。无论您的经验水平如何,它都是一款不可或缺的动画程序。 了解 Maya 界面即使起初可能令人生畏,但熟悉该软件是熟练掌握它的第一步。 重要元素包括: - 视口:这是用于创建和修改 3D 动画的工作区。通过实时可视化,用户可以调整灯光、纹理和对象。它通过可配置视图和无缝导航等功能,提高了动画制作工作流程的准确性和创造力。
- 通道盒和属性编辑器:通道盒提供了对缩放、旋转和位置等变换属性的快速访问。同时,属性编辑器提供了全面的对象属性自定义,使用户能够精确控制对象行为和动画,从而实现富有成效且富有创意的 Wokrflows。
- 时间轴:它是播放和关键帧管理的重要组成部分。它位于底部,使艺术家能够实时查看和修改动画序列。为了确保对其项目中的运动和时间进行精确控制,用户可以交互式地修改 关键帧、在帧之间拖动以及指定播放范围。
- 大纲视图:它提供了场景组件的分层表示,是动画师的重要工具。它简化了资产的选择、组织和重命名。拖放功能对于简化的工作流程和提高生产力至关重要,因为它允许动画师有效地父子化对象和管理复杂的场景。
- 工具架:它提供了对常用命令和工具的便捷访问。通过允许用户将脚本、工具和快捷方式存储在可自定义的选项卡中,它可以提高工作流程的生产力。此功能通过简化建模、动画和渲染过程,促进了创造力和生产力。
Maya 动画基础a. 关键帧和时间轴- 关键帧:它们表示对象特征(如位置、旋转或缩放)发生变化的精确时刻。动画师通过在时间轴上放置关键帧来产生运动和变化。Maya 通过在关键帧之间插值帧,可以实现逼真、流畅的角色和对象动画。
- 设置关键帧:关键帧通过在特定时间指定对象的位置、旋转或缩放来产生运动。选择对象、导航到时间轴帧并修改其属性后,按“S”键设置关键帧。为了创建平滑的动画,请重复此操作。
- 播放控件:它们对于预览动画是必不可少的。它们允许用户在时间滑块中播放、暂停、倒带或逐帧浏览,这些控件位于时间滑块中。动画师可以通过更改播放速度和范围来微调运动。这些工具通过提供平滑的逐帧导航,确保了动画操作的准确性。
b. 图形编辑器- 它是动画师精确控制关键帧动画的重要工具。它允许用户通过可视化运动曲线来修改动画的时间、插值和缓动。动画师可以通过图形编辑器中的运动微调来提高动画质量并确保流畅的过渡。
c. 动画工具- 变换工具:它们对于动画至关重要,因为它们允许在三维空间中精确地操作对象。这些工具包括平移、旋转和缩放,动画师可以使用它们来更改对象的位置、位置和尺寸。您必须熟练掌握变换工具才能在 Maya 中创建逼真的动画。
- 驱动关键帧(Set Driven Key):这是 Autodesk Maya 中一种强大的动画技术,用于链接属性以创建复杂的动画。通过使用一组关键帧,它使一个属性(驱动程序)能够控制另一个属性(被驱动程序)。该技术特别适用于角色绑定和机械运动,在提供更大控制和多功能性的同时简化了动画。
- 控制器:在动画中,这些工具用于控制对象运动。它们允许对象之间建立特定的连接,例如缩放、旋转和位置。点约束、方向约束和缩放约束是常见的类别,它们有助于动画师创建逼真的交互,简化动画流程,并有效地管理对象依赖关系。
角色绑定和动画a. 绑定基础- 关节和骨骼:它们构成了角色骨骼的基本元素。骨骼连接关节,关节充当枢轴点,为运动提供层次结构。通过允许无缝变形和控制角色姿势和动作,正确配置的关节和骨骼可以实现逼真的动画。理解这个基础对于有效地绑定至关重要。
- 蒙皮(Skinning):在动画过程中实现平滑自然的运动。它涉及为顶点分配权重,确定每根骨骼对网格的影响程度,并微调变形以确保逼真的运动。正确的 蒙皮 对于高质量动画至关重要。
- IK 和 FK:对于行走等动态运动,IK 会计算关节旋转以到达精确的末端执行器位置。FK 通过涉及关节的独立旋转,提供平滑弧线的精细控制。掌握 IK 和 FK 对于在 Maya 中创建逼真的角色动画至关重要。
b. 角色动画- 逐帧动画(Pose-to-Pose Animation):它首先建立角色的主要动作和情感,以及开发关键姿势。之后,动画师会打磨场景之间的过渡,以确保流畅、生动的运动。这种技术对于创建逼真的角色动画和引人入胜的故事至关重要,因为它提供了控制、准确性和清晰的工作流程。
- 面部动画:这是 Maya 角色动画的关键,为数字艺术作品注入活力和情感。动画师通过调整面部绑定来创建表达意图、个性和情绪的情感。Maya 的强大功能,如混合形状和动作捕捉集成,使得复杂的唇语同步和微妙的运动成为可能,确保角色能够吸引观众并促进动画项目中的故事讲述和互动。
- 唇语同步:将嘴部运动与口语词语协调起来,可以增强情感表达和真实感。Maya 的高级功能使动画师能够仔细地将音素与匹配的帧进行匹配,以确保精确的时间,从而使角色看起来吸引人且真实,从而增强观众的观看体验。
高级动画技术非线性动画- Trax 编辑器:它使动画师可以轻松地编辑、分层和混合动画剪辑。通过在多个设置或角色之间重用动画,此工具促进了创造力和适应性。凭借其平滑的混合、时间调整和剪辑操作功能,Trax 编辑器简化了操作,非常适合复杂项目。这确保了准确且动态的动画。
- 动画层:它使艺术家能够自由地创建和修改动画。动画师可以通过堆叠图层来添加、修改或组合动作,而不会更改原始动画。这种方法非常适合打磨复杂的动作或尝试不同的变体,是提高动画工作流程的创造力和生产力的有效方式。
动态模拟- 粒子:它们对于创建烟雾、火焰和爆炸等动态模拟至关重要。这些微小单元与重力、风和碰撞等力相互作用,以描绘动态系统。作为逼真且引人入胜的动画的关键组成部分,Maya 的强大功能使动画师能够操纵粒子行为、应用着色器并产生视觉上令人惊叹的效果。
- 布料模拟:它为动画布料提供了逼真的动态效果。艺术家可以使用布料来生成窗帘、衣服和其他对碰撞或风做出自然反应的物体的逼真运动。这种动态模拟通过视觉上吸引人的、基于物理的布料行为来提升动画场景,这些行为会与环境互动,为增强故事叙述增添真实感和流畅性。
- 流体模拟:通过模拟水、烟雾、火焰和气体等自然现象,为动画注入真实感。动画师可以通过使用复杂的动态模型来创建复杂、物理上逼真的流体行为。Maya 的工具能够精确控制粘度、密度和流动模式,从而在复杂的动画项目中实现创造力,同时提升电影和视频游戏的电影外观。
动作捕捉- 导入数据:导入 mocap 文件时,会使用自定义骨骼或 Maya 的 Humanlike 将运动数据映射到绑定的模型上。为了创建逼真的运动,动画师会组合动画、修改节奏并使用物理效果。这个简化的过程通过弥合真人表演和数字艺术之间的差距,增强了视频游戏、电影和虚拟世界的真实感。
- 编辑数据:导入动作捕捉文件是第一步,之后会对关键帧进行调整并对关节运动进行改进。为了提高真实感,编辑人员可以添加二次运动、平滑过渡并修复错误。通过使用图形编辑器和 Trax 编辑器等工具来辅助时间控制,动画质量得到了提高。
渲染和导出动画- 渲染引擎:通过提供灯光、着色、纹理和效果的参数,它们会影响场景的渲染方式。Arnold、V-Ray 和 Renderman 等知名引擎提供各种功能,可针对各种任务优化渲染速度和视觉准确性,确保获得逼真的结果。
- 灯光和着色:它们为场景增加了深度、真实感和情感。着色建立了表面特征,而灯光则调节了物体的照明方式,产生了阴影并增强了纹理。结合使用时,它们为 3D 模型提供了动态、逼真的图形,有助于讲述故事。
- 文件格式:选择正确的文件格式对于保持兼容性和质量至关重要。Alembic 非常适合复杂的模拟,而 FBX 则可以保留关键帧数据和绑定,这是常见的格式。这两种格式都提供了无缝的软件集成,从而实现了有效的动画制作工作流程。
- 导出设置:这包括配置适当的导出参数以确保生成高质量的输出。用户可以选择 Alembic 或 FBX 等文件格式以实现跨平台兼容性。网格导出选项、动画曲线和帧范围是重要的设置。正确调整这些设置可确保与其他程序(如游戏引擎或最终渲染)无缝集成。
技巧和最佳实践优化- 高效的工作流程:使用图层和对象名称来组织您的场景。
- 场景优化:从场景中删除多余的组件,并在可能的情况下使用分辨率较低的模型来简化场景。
- 资源和学习
- 教程和资源:您可以通过各种在线课程和教程来学习 Maya。
- 社区和支持:加入论坛和社区,与其他 Maya 用户交流并获得项目帮助。
结论要熟练掌握动画,需要花费时间和精力,并彻底理解 Maya 的工具和功能。遵循本教程并利用 Maya 的众多功能,您将有望制作出精美的动画。保持好奇心,不断尝试新事物,并持续提升您的技能。
|